> This is a great news in the new year. I remembered the " green summer"
> programs that most students join every summer. When I was at my university,
> we raised fund from companies to finance all of the programs. Students were
> sent to remote area, lived and worked with locals, they supported the
> elderly, taught children, organized sport events for the youth, and built
> schools, ect... Above all these students were on their own budget, they came
> to see the country, to understand the people, and to learn great lessons.
>
> I am glad to see more and more ambitious and heartful youth activities
> like this.

> > Some of my first semester students have self-organized a small donation
> > drive as a concluding project within, but separate from, an Organizational
> > Behaviour class that I teach and that they study.  I lecture at RMIT in
> > Hanoi.
> >
> > These students have organized a three day trip to Ha Giang to provide
> > clothing donations under a project that they are driving called, "Warm
> > Winter"; we leave on this *upcoming Saturday afternoon* .  It is truly
> > amazing how well planned and coordinated this small project is where all
> > necessary approvals and arrangements have been coordinated in a relatively
> > short period of time.  I am truly proud of my students for the wonderful
> > work that they have taken upon themselves. It shows the spirit, dedication
> > and care of these students who have decided, in addition to the very
> > challenging work they do in our first semester class, to commit themselves
> > to serving the needs of others.  I might say, that they are wonderful
> > examples of the future generation that will help lead Vietnam to the
> > prosperity that it rightfully deserves.
